The Cost Of Short Term Drug and Alcohol Rehabilitation in Eatonville, Washington

Many people struggling with drug addiction typically discover the cost of rehab is too steep for them. As a result, they might decide to forgo treatment - forgetting that addiction is always more expensive in the long run.

Contingent on the type of treatment you are looking into, you can be sure that the facility will require you to take care of the costs up front. Yet, there are reasonably affordable treatment options in Eatonville that you can use to offset these costs - one of these is short term drug rehabilitation.

Short term drug treatment is usually less expensive than long-term treatment because you will only participate in the program for a limited period. This means that you finally have a lower priced alternative that you can count on to overcome your substance abuse and addiction.

In some cases, you may even find that your medical insurance will take care of the cost of your treatment if you choose short term drug rehabilitation. Although, many insurance plans have limitations on the total amount they may cover - or the entire duration of treatment that they will cover. Still, many short term treatment centers are fully covered by insurance.

Thus, if the cost of rehab is a significant consideration for you, short term rehabilitation may be the appropriate choice. As much as you may want to receive the best, most intensive type of rehab, your funds might keep you from selecting other options like long term drug treatment.

Even with this somewhat low cost, short term rehabilitation could possibly work for you. However, the effectiveness of the treatment will largely depend on you as an individual. If your addiction has been going on for a long time, it is doubtful that this form of rehabilitation will be successful in the long-run for you. This is because it is better suited for clients who have only just began showing early symptoms of addiction.

Generally, short term drug treatment is best suited for addicts who have not been abusing drugs for a long time and for those who cannot come up with the funds for a longer rehab program.
